Is Camilla a Good Place to Live?

Based on current data, Camilla receives an overall livability score of 2.3 out of 5.0, earning a grade of C. Key strengths include low crime rates, affordable housing. Areas to be aware of include above-average unemployment, an elevated poverty rate, below-average incomes. Camilla has some notable strengths but also faces challenges that prospective residents should consider.

Economy & Jobs

The median household income in Camilla is $26,720, 64% below the national average of $75,149. The unemployment rate of 6.1% is somewhat elevated compared to the national rate of 3.6%. The poverty rate of 42.6% exceeds the national average of 12.4%, indicating economic hardship for a significant portion of the population. Workers commute an average of 28 minutes.

Cost of Living & Housing

The median home value in Camilla is $74,400, 74% below the national median — off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$785 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. At just 2.8x median income, home prices are very affordable relative to local earnings.

Safety & Crime

Violent crime in Camilla is below the national average at 256 per 100,000 residents (U.S. avg: 380). Property crime occurs at a rate of 3,787 per 100,000, 93% above the national average.

Education

8.6%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 79.9% have completed high school. Area schools have an average test score of 4.9/10.

Climate & Weather

Camilla enjoys a moderate climate with an average annual temperature of 66°F. Winters average 49°F in January while summers reach 81°F in July. Annual precipitation totals 51.6 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 44.

Camilla has a population of 5,158 with a density of 782 people per square mile. The median age is 38.7 years, 1% younger than the national median of 38.9. The city is predominantly Black (73.6%), with 13.7% White.
